Antonio Dueñas is a scholar working on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Ophthalmology and Orthopedics and Sports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Antonio Dueñas has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 416 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, 3 papers in Ophthalmology and 3 papers in Orthopedics and Sports Medicine. Recurrent topics in Antonio Dueñas’s work include Vitamin D Research Studies (3 papers), Bone health and osteoporosis research (3 papers) and Retinal and Macular Surgery (3 papers). Antonio Dueñas is often cited by papers focused on Vitamin D Research Studies (3 papers), Bone health and osteoporosis research (3 papers) and Retinal and Macular Surgery (3 papers). Antonio Dueñas collaborates with scholars based in Spain, United States and Russia. Antonio Dueñas's co-authors include José Luis Pérez‐Castrillón, Gonzalo Hernández, Alberto Sanz, Laura Abad, J. M. Chaves, Guillermo Burillo‐Putze, Pere Munné, Jesús Silva, Cristina Dı́az-Jullien and P. Escudero and has published in prestigious journals such as International Journal of Molecular Sciences, The American Journal of Cardiology and British Journal of Ophthalmology.
